Protein Description

TAS2R16 is a member of the TAS2R family of taste receptors, which are G protein-coupled receptors (GPCRs) primarily responsible for detecting bitter compounds. Research into TAS2R16 is significant due to its potential role in sensing dietary toxins and its implications in nutrition and toxicology. TAS2R16 is expressed in the taste buds, where it contributes to the perception of bitter flavors, a response that is evolutionarily important for survival by helping organisms avoid harmful substances. Genetic variations in TAS2R16 have been linked to individual differences in taste perception and dietary preferences, which can influence health outcomes. Understanding the structure and function of this receptor through recombinant protein studies can provide insights into its activation mechanism and ligand specificity, thereby enhancing our knowledge of bitterness perception. Furthermore, TAS2R16's interactions with various biologically relevant compounds can pave the way for novel applications in food science, pharmacology, and understanding taste-related disorders. Overall, characterizing TAS2R16 as a recombinant protein is pivotal for both fundamental research and practical applications, enhancing our grasp of human taste perception and its evolutionary significance.
